All the best, Ria Otanes -------------------------- 17 January 2019 Dear Community Members, As chair of the Customer Standing Committee I am providing you with our December 2018 monthly findings on the performance of Public Technical Identifiers (PTI). I am very pleased to inform you the CSC has concluded that PTI’s overall performance over December 2018 was “Excellent” - PTI met the service level agreement at 100%. The CSC was informed of no escalations. The related PTI report to the CSC, listing the individual service level metrics along with their actual and historical performance, can be found at: https://www.iana.org/performance/csc-reports. I’m also pleased to inform you that at its last meeting on 15 January 2019, and after extensive discussions and hard work the CSC has approved and adopted the amended Remedial Action Procedure (RAP), to meet the requirements of our updated Charter. The amended RAP will become effective after adoption by PTI and publication. The documents can be found on the CSC wikispace: https://community.icann.org/display/CSC/Documents The CSC regular meeting is scheduled at or around the 15th every month, and the CSC report on the PTI performance is sent out shortly after that meeting.
